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Age between 25 and 60 years Good general health with signed informed consent Good oral hygiene with full mouth plaque score Systemically healthy subjects requiring and opting dental implants for partial edentulous space of atleast 2 neighbouring teeth in mandibular posterior region. Clinical situation fit for implantation as judged by the examining physician or principal investigator (satisfactory soft and hard tissue conditions and occlusion).
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Pregnant or lactating females Bisphosphonate treatment (either at the time of screening or in the history) Radiotherapy, irradiation of the mandible or the maxilla (either at the time of screening or in the history) INR more than 2.5. Known HIV, Hepatitis B or Hepatitis C infection. Known allergy to any component of the implant or the implant guide. Untreated periodontal disease and or caries Conditions that might render intraoral manipulation impossible (limited mouth opening, excessive gag reflex
